A new big challenge in computational biology is the mapping of large numbers of short oligonucleotide reads to a reference genome while allowing a few errors. This thesis describes a method applied in the successful Eland tool to solve this problem and attempts an implementation in SeqAn, a bioinformatical C++ library.
